引言
ALMA Linux,作为Red Hat Enterprise Linux(RHEL)的一个分支,旨在为开发者提供一个完全免费、开源且遵循RHEL的操作系统。对于想要深入了解和使用ALMA Linux的开发者来说,熟悉其官方文档是非常重要的。本文将为你提供一个全面而实用的文档攻略,帮助你快速上手ALMA Linux。
安装与配置
安装ALMA Linux
- 下载镜像:首先,你需要从ALMA Linux官网下载适合你硬件的安装镜像。
- 创建USB启动盘:使用工具如 Rufus 或 balenaEtcher 将下载的镜像烧录到USB启动盘中。
- 启动并安装:重启计算机,进入BIOS设置,将USB启动盘设置为第一启动项,然后启动计算机进行安装。
系统配置
- 网络配置:在安装过程中,需要配置网络,确保系统可以访问互联网。
- 分区:合理分区是优化系统性能的关键。你可以选择手动分区或让安装程序自动分区。
- 用户与密码:设置根用户密码和创建普通用户。
基础使用
命令行工具
ALMA Linux提供了丰富的命令行工具,以下是一些基础命令:
ls:列出目录内容cd:更改目录cp:复制文件mv:移动或重命名文件rm:删除文件mkdir:创建目录
软件包管理
ALMA Linux使用Docker作为其软件包管理器,以下是一些常用命令:
dnf install [package]:安装软件包dnf remove [package]:移除软件包dnf update:更新软件包
开发环境搭建
编程语言
ALMA Linux支持多种编程语言,如Python、Java、C++等。以下是如何安装Python 3的示例:
sudo dnf install python3
开发工具
对于开发者来说,一些常用的开发工具包括:
git:版本控制工具gcc/g++:C/C++编译器make:自动构建工具
安全性
用户权限管理
合理管理用户权限是确保系统安全的关键。你可以使用sudo命令以root权限执行命令,或者为特定任务创建服务账户。
软件更新
定期更新软件包可以修复已知的安全漏洞。使用以下命令进行更新:
sudo dnf update
官方文档资源
ALMA Linux提供了详细的官方文档,以下是一些重要的文档链接:
结语
掌握ALMA Linux的官方文档是开发者高效工作的基石。通过本文的攻略,希望你能快速上手并开始使用ALMA Linux。记住,多查阅官方文档,多实践,你将更加熟练地掌握这个强大的操作系统。
